Betterment Quote by Edward R. Murrow
“I was greatly influenced by one of my teachers. She had a zeal not so much for perfection as for steady betterment-she demanded not excellence so much as integrity.”
About This Quote
She valued integrity over flawless performance, encouraging continuous improvement rather than unattainable perfection.
In simple terms: Integrity matters more than perfection.
Focus on honesty and steady growth.
